Trust Planning Helps Protect Families Across Generations
Creating a trust is one of the most effective ways to preserve assets, simplify wealth transfers, and ensure that personal wishes are honored. Families in Washington often use trusts to avoid unnecessary probate delays, provide for loved ones with specific needs, and maintain greater control over how assets are distributed. What Defines Modern Legal Services?
Modern legal services are characterized by efficiency, accessibility, and personalization. Law firms and independent practitioners now leverage advanced tools to deliver faster and more accurate results.
Technology Integration
Legal professionals use AI-powered research tools, automated documentation systems, and cloud-based platforms to streamline operations.
Client-Centered Approach
Clients expect transparency, fixed pricing models, and real-time updates on their cases.
Key Areas of Legal Services in 2026
Corporate and Business Law
Businesses rely on legal experts for compliance, mergers, intellectual property, and contract management.
Personal Legal Services
From family law to estate planning, individuals seek tailored solutions for personal matters.
Digital and Cyber Law
With the rise of online platforms, legal services now address data protection, cybersecurity, and digital rights.
